A complete collection―over 300 poems―from one of this country s most influential poets.
"These are poems which blaze and pulse on the page."―Adrienne Rich "The first declaration of a black, lesbian feminist identity took place in these poems, and set the terms―beautifully, forcefully―for contemporary multicultural and pluralist debate."―Publishers Weekly "This is an amazing collection of poetry by . . . one of our best contemporary poets. . . . Her poems are powerful, often political, always lyrical and profoundly moving."―Chuckanut Reader Magazine "What a deep pleasure to encounter Audre Lorde s most potent genius . . . you will welcome the sheer accessibility and the force and beauty of this volume."―Out MagazineThis is the definitive and complete Audre Lorde collection, including original and revised versions of Lorde s previously unavailable early poems and her later work, which Robin Morgan calls "sinewy, lyrical, celebratory even in the face of death." Lorde was able to write indignantly about political matters ("jessehelms," her excoriation of the right-wing icon, is outrageously funny and angry), and her eloquence from the margins made her an inspiration to many readers. Lorde s writings about family, erotic love, and quiet, beautiful moments of reflection also leave a deep impression. As Adrienne Rich has noted: "These are poems which blaze and pulse on the page."
